I have flown them before, but I don't have all that much time on SDs, so it's hard to compare. Both are by far some of the most capable and fun to fly kites that I've tried -always a good time.
The FL does some things that I've fallen in love with - very stable in both fades and turtles, easy tricks in both low and high wind, multi-lazys and jacobs ladders that just don't seem possible - its so reliable you can do them 6 inches or so off the ground with confidence, light pull but great line feedback, easy combos, smooth easy tricks. It also has the best combination of being both floaty and trick-able that I've tried - it never feels clunky or heavy.
I can't say enough good things about the kite. If you like the SD, I would imagine you will love the Fearless.
